Legend entered their tilt with Heritage on Tuesday with two cons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with three. They blew past the Heritage Eagles 3-0. This was payback for the Titans, who suffered a 3-2 loss the last time these two teams met.
The final score came out to 25-21, 25-15, 25-16.
Legend was lethal from the service line and finished the game with ten a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least five aces in eight consecutive matches.
Legend pushed their record up to 6-2 with the win, which was their ninth straight at home dating back to last season. As for Heritage, they are on a five-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-7.
Legend is taking a road trip to take on Regis Jesuit at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Heritage, they will venture away from home to square off against Chaparral at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day.
